首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将文本字段的值传递给Swift3中的按钮单击函数?

在Swift3中,可以通过以下步骤将文本字段的值传递给按钮的点击函数:

  1. 首先,确保你已经在视图控制器中创建了一个文本字段和一个按钮,并且已经将它们连接到你的代码中。
  2. 在视图控制器类中,创建一个用于处理按钮点击事件的函数。例如,你可以创建一个名为buttonClicked的函数。
代码语言:swift
复制

@IBAction func buttonClicked(_ sender: UIButton) {

代码语言:txt
复制
   // 在这里处理按钮点击事件

}

代码语言:txt
复制
  1. buttonClicked函数中,获取文本字段的值。你可以使用文本字段的text属性来获取它的值。
代码语言:swift
复制

@IBAction func buttonClicked(_ sender: UIButton) {

代码语言:txt
复制
   let textFieldValue = textField.text
代码语言:txt
复制
   // 在这里处理按钮点击事件,并使用textFieldValue变量来访问文本字段的值

}

代码语言:txt
复制
  1. 现在,你可以在buttonClicked函数中使用textFieldValue变量来访问文本字段的值,并进行相应的操作。

这样,当按钮被点击时,文本字段的值将会传递给按钮的点击函数。你可以根据具体的需求,在buttonClicked函数中进行进一步的处理。

腾讯云相关产品和产品介绍链接地址:

请注意,以上仅为腾讯云的一些相关产品,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python 自动化指南(繁琐工作自动化)第二版:二十、使用 GUI 自动化控制键盘和鼠标

“全部记录”、“XY 记录”、“RGB 记录”和“RGB 十六进制记录”按钮会将各自信息写入窗口中文本字段。您可以通过单击保存日志按钮来保存日志文本字段文本。 默认情况下,3 秒。...这些按键作用取决于哪个窗口是活动,哪个文本字段具有焦点。您可能希望首先向所需文本字段发送鼠标单击,以确保它获得焦点。...图 20-7:本项目使用表格 概括地说,下面是您程序应该做事情: 点击表单第一个文本字段。 在表单中移动,在每个字段中键入信息。 单击提交按钮。 对下一组数据重复这个过程。...第三步:开始输入数据 一个for循环将遍历formData列表每个字典,将字典递给 PyAutoGUI 函数,该函数将虚拟地在文本字段中键入内容。 将以下代码添加到您程序: #!...然后,您可以单击文本编辑器文本字段,例如,通过使用pyautogui.click()将100或200像素添加到top和left属性,将键盘焦点放在那里。

8.3K51

事件_窗体

本实项目创建步骤记录: 1、创建两个Webform窗体 2、实现功能::在form1窗体中点击按钮---->将文本传递到,From2文本。...2)、在单击事件方法前声明一个 委托字段 public event Mydel _mdl; 4、事件定义完毕!...5、单击按钮后,显示窗体Form2,同时对这个按钮注册一个事件 1)、this._mdl += 输入完毕后,, 通常是点击 Tab键进行事件补全;; 这里不需要。。...就是用来改变Form2文本内容。 4)、其实这个方法SetTxt()就是存在,Form2。。那么,这就需要手动写这个方法 在Form2类。..._mdl+=new Mydel(f2.SetTxt); 8)、所以返回委托定义地方,添加上 参数 string name 9)、F6生成成功! 6、如何呢?

1.1K00

Swift4语法新特性 原

在开发,可能会产生读写权限冲突情况有3种: 1.inout 参数读写权限冲突     一般情况下,类型参总会产生复制操作。inout参数则使得函数内可以直接修改外部变量。...在函数,inout参数从声明开始到函数结束,这个变量始终开启着写权限,对应上面代码,number参数开启这写权限,stepSize则进行了读访问,如此则满足上面的权限冲突规则,会产生读写冲突。...3.类型属性读写访问权限冲突     在Siwft语言中,像结构体,枚举和元组中都有属性概念。...Swift4引入了字面量创建多行文本语法,例如: var multiLineString = """ abcd jaki 24 """ print(multiLineString) 这种方式可以大大减少在创建字符串时人为添加换行符...四、增强区间运算符     Swift语言中区间运算符使用起来十分方便,例如在Swift3,我们若要遍历数组范围,可以使用如下代码: //Swift3代码 let array = ["1","2

1.7K30

【React】243- 在 React 组件中使用 Refs 指南

,并赋值给 this.firstRef 在 render() 方法内部,将构造函数创建 ref 传递给 div 接下来,让我们看一个在 React 组件中使用 refs 示例。...我们构建了一个按钮,当单击它时,该页面会自动聚焦在输入框上。...示例如下: 在这个例子,我们创建了一个 input 输入框来输入。然后,当单击提交按钮时,我们将读取此,并在控制台打印。...在 render 函数,我们希望读取 form 下输入框。我们如何读取这个? 通过为 input 指定一个 ref ,然后读取 ref 。...在上面的示例,我们使用 input 标签创建了一个名为 TextInput 组件。那么,我们如何将 ref 传递或转发到 input 标签呢?

3.9K30

【React】282- 在 React 组件中使用 Refs 指南

,并赋值给 this.firstRef 在 render() 方法内部,将构造函数创建 ref 传递给 div 接下来,让我们看一个在 React 组件中使用 refs 示例。...我们构建了一个按钮,当单击它时,该页面会自动聚焦在输入框上。...示例如下: 在这个例子,我们创建了一个 input 输入框来输入。然后,当单击提交按钮时,我们将读取此,并在控制台打印。...在 render 函数,我们希望读取 form 下输入框。我们如何读取这个? 通过为 input 指定一个 ref ,然后读取 ref 。...在上面的示例,我们使用 input 标签创建了一个名为 TextInput 组件。那么,我们如何将 ref 传递或转发到 input 标签呢?

3.3K10

C#学习笔记——show()与showDialog()区别

按钮会隐藏窗体,并将DialogResult属性设置为DialogResult.Cancel 与无模式窗体不同,当用户单击对话框关闭窗体按钮或设置DialogResult属性时,不调用窗体Close...由于在窗体创建之前是无法得知显示方式,所以在窗体构造函数,Modal属性总是对应false,所以我们只能在Load事件或者之后利用Modal属性 怎么确定窗体间所有者关系?...= this; f2.ShowDialog( ); 这样f2所有者就是Form1 B.WinForm窗体 了解了窗体显示相关知识,接着总结一下窗体方法: 1.通过构造函数...特点:是单向(不可以互相传),实现简单 实现代码如下: 在窗体Form2 int value1; string value2; public Form2 ( int value1...Form2Value,获取和设置textBox1文本 public string Form2Value { get { return this.textBox1.Text; } set

1.9K41

JavaSwing_8.1:焦点事件及其监听器 - FocusEvent、FocusListener

当组件获得或失去键盘焦点时,将调用侦听器对象相关方法,并将FocusEvent传递给它。 API focusGained ? focusLost ? 2 FocusAdapter ?...当组件获得或失去键盘焦点时,可调用侦听器对象相关方法,并将 FocusEvent 传递给它。 API focusGained ? focusLost ?...例如,当焦点从按钮转到文本字段时,按钮会触发焦点丢失事件(文本字段为相反组件),然后文本字段会触发焦点获取事件(带有按钮作为相反组件)。失去焦点以及获得焦点事件可能是暂时。...什么也没有发生,因为使用setRequestFocusEnabled(false)使文本区域不可点击。 单击文本字段以将焦点返回到初始组件。 按键盘上Tab。焦点移到组合框,并跳过标签。...焦点移至按钮单击另一个窗口,以便FocusEventDemo窗口失去焦点。为按钮生成一个临时焦点丢失事件。 单击FocusEventDemo窗口顶部。该按钮触发了聚焦事件。

4.6K10

优化 React APP 10 种方法

文本输入2并Click Me连续单击按钮,我们将看到ReactComponent将被重新渲染一次,并且永远不会被渲染。 它将上一个道具和状态对象字段与下一个道具和状态对象字段进行浅层比较。...参见,在ReactCompo。cheapableFunc在JSX呈现,对于每次重新呈现,都会调用该函数,并将返回呈现在DOM上。...现在,看到按下按钮时,该按钮会将状态设置为0。如果连续按下按钮,则状态始终保持不变,但是尽管传递给其道具状态相同,但My组件仍将重新渲染。...它在状态对象具有数据。如果我们在输入文本输入一个并按下Click Me按钮,则将呈现输入。...如果再次单击按钮,我们将有另一个重新渲染,不是这样,因为前一个状态对象和下一个状态对象将具有相同data,但是由于setState新状态对象创建,React将看到差异状态对象引用和触发器重新呈现

33.8K20

excel常用操作大全

在EXCEL菜单单击文件-页面设置-工作表-打印标题;您可以通过按下折叠对话框按钮并用鼠标划定范围,将标题设置在顶端或左端。这样,Excel会自动将您指定部分添加为每页页眉。...快速输入相同数量内容 选择单元格格区域,输入一个,然后按Ctrl+ Ener在选定单元格格区域中一次输入相同。 12、只记得函数名字,却记不起函数参数,怎么办?...要将格式化操作复制到数据另一部分,请使用“格式化画笔”按钮。选择具有所需源格式单元格,单击工具栏上“格式画笔”按钮,鼠标变成画笔形状,然后单击要格式化单元格以复制格式。...将它移动到您想要添加斜线,开始位置,按住鼠标左键并将其拖动到结束位置,释放鼠标,将绘制斜线。此外,您可以使用“文本框”按钮轻松地在斜线顶部和底部添加文本,但是文本周围有边框。...定义名称有两种方法:一种是选择单元格区字段,直接在名称框输入名称;另一种方法是选择要命名单元格区字段,然后选择插入\名称\定义,然后在当前工作簿名称对话框单击该名称。

19.2K10

最完整VBA字符串知识介绍(续:消息框和输入框)

消息框返回 MsgBox函数能用于返回一个,此对应于用户在消息框上单击按钮。根据消息框显示按钮,用户单击后,MsgBox函数可以返回。...返回可以是以下之一: 图16 输入框 Visual Basic语言提供了一个函数,允许向用户请求信息,用户可以在对话框文本字段中键入信息。...输入框默认 有时,即使提供了明确请求,用户也可能不会提供新,而是单击“确定”。问题是仍然需要获取文本,并且可能希望将其包含在表达式。...可以通过使用默认填充文本框来解决此问题,并向用户提供示例。为此,InputBox函数提供了第三个参数。 要向用户提供示例或默认,将第三个参数传递给InputBox函数。...图19 注意,当输入框显示默认时,该位于文本,并且该已被选中。因此,如果该没有问题,用户可以接受它并单击“确定”。

1.9K20

Python 自动化指南(繁琐工作自动化)第二版:十二、网络爬取

为此,在您网络浏览器右键单击(或CTRL并单击 MacOS)任何网页,并选择查看源或查看页面源以查看页面的 HTML 文本(参见图 12-3 )。这是您浏览器实际收到文本。...对于BeautifulSoup对象 HTML 每个匹配,该列表将包含一个Tag对象。标签可以传递给str()函数来显示它们所代表 HTML 标签。...内置 Python 函数min()返回传递给最小整数或浮点参数。(还有一个内置max()函数,它返回传递给最大参数。)...这个方法可以用来跟踪一个链接,在一个单选按钮上进行选择,单击一个提交按钮,或者触发鼠标单击元素时可能发生任何事情。...id,前面的代码就会用提供文本填充这些文本字段

8.7K70

最佳实战|如何使用腾讯云微搭从0到1开发企业门户应用

此处需要注意,在放置图片与文本组件时,大纲树图片组件需要在文本组件上方,否则位置会颠倒。 创建模型变量 单击右上角变量,进入变量编辑页面。...此处需要注意方法创建先后顺序,需要先进行变量赋值后再绑定页面跳转方法,否则会导致页面跳转时参为空。...[56b4303944a5402f2606de23225e677e.png] 依次选中应用场景详情页组件,并在右侧配置区单击变量绑定按钮。...此处需要注意方法创建先后顺序,需要先进行变量赋值后再绑定页面跳转方法,否则会导致页面跳转时参为空。...[fb86dde33a8e0d37095b9b6176821770.png] 依次选中动态详情页组件,并在右侧配置区单击变量绑定按钮

1.3K30

最佳实战|如何使用腾讯云微搭从0到1开发企业门户应用

此处需要注意,在放置图片与文本组件时,大纲树图片组件需要在文本组件上方,否则位置会颠倒。 创建模型变量 单击右上角变量,进入变量编辑页面。...此处需要注意方法创建先后顺序,需要先进行变量赋值后再绑定页面跳转方法,否则会导致页面跳转时参为空。...[56b4303944a5402f2606de23225e677e.png] 依次选中应用场景详情页组件,并在右侧配置区单击变量绑定按钮。...此处需要注意方法创建先后顺序,需要先进行变量赋值后再绑定页面跳转方法,否则会导致页面跳转时参为空。...[fb86dde33a8e0d37095b9b6176821770.png] 依次选中动态详情页组件,并在右侧配置区单击变量绑定按钮

2.6K82

最佳实战|如何使用腾讯云微搭从0到1开发企业门户应用

此处需要注意,在放置图片与文本组件时,大纲树图片组件需要在文本组件上方,否则位置会颠倒。 创建模型变量 单击右上角变量,进入变量编辑页面。...此处需要注意方法创建先后顺序,需要先进行变量赋值后再绑定页面跳转方法,否则会导致页面跳转时参为空。...[56b4303944a5402f2606de23225e677e.png] 依次选中应用场景详情页组件,并在右侧配置区单击变量绑定按钮。...此处需要注意方法创建先后顺序,需要先进行变量赋值后再绑定页面跳转方法,否则会导致页面跳转时参为空。...[fb86dde33a8e0d37095b9b6176821770.png] 依次选中动态详情页组件,并在右侧配置区单击变量绑定按钮

1.4K30

SAP应用界面开发-工具栏对象GUI Status与GUI Title

2.填写完成后回车或者双击,进入文本类型设置界面,将选择文本类型设置为静态文本选项(Static Text)。 ?   3.单击 ?...其中功能代码(Function Code)为基本描述,函数文本(Function Text)为描述字段,图标名称(ICON Name)用于设置该按钮图标,信息文本(INFO Text)为程序运行时按钮所显示信息文本...4.设置完成后,单击 ? 按钮,系统将弹出Assign Function To Function Key对话框,由用户为新增按钮分配一快捷键。 ?   5.选择某功能键字段单击 ?...由于工具栏是自定义,原系统标准功能按钮(如:SAVE、BACK、CANCEL、EXIT等)都需要重新设定,维护Standard ToolBar页面按钮字段Function Key。   ...该描述将出现在Report标题栏,还可以输入&符号作为Title,当程序运行时对其填充动态文本。如下图: ?   2.单击 ?

4.6K20

Google Earth Engine(GEE)——用户界面的小按钮

在代码编辑器左侧ui文档选项卡探索API 全部功能。以下示例使用该ui包来说明用于制作小部件、定义用户单击小部件时行为以及显示小部件基本功能。...函数: ui.Button(label, onClick, disabled, style) 带有文本标签可点击按钮。 参数: 标签(字符串,可选): 按钮标签。默认为空字符串。...onClick(功能,可选): 单击按钮时触发回调。回调传递给按钮小部件。 禁用(布尔,可选): 按钮是否被禁用。默认为假。...参数 onClick()是另一个函数,只要单击按钮就会运行。这种在事件发生时调用函数(“回调”函数机制称为“事件处理程序”,在 UI 库中被广泛使用。...在这个例子,当按钮被点击时,函数会打印“Hello, world!” 到控制台。 请注意,与ee.*命名空间中对象不同,命名空间中对象 ui.*是可变

11510

WPF自学入门(八)WPF窗体之间交互

今天我们一起来看一下WPF窗体之间交互-窗体之间。有两个窗体,一个是父窗体,一个是子窗体。要将父窗体文本递给子窗体控件。我们该怎么实现?...接下来我们一起来实现窗体之间,在父窗体上我们放两个控件,一个文本框TxtMessage,另一个是按钮BtnSend.子窗体上放一个文本框TxtInput。 父窗体界面: ?...子窗体界面: ? 要实现,我们首先要在子窗体定义一个可读可写公用字符串:getMessage。然后在父窗体按下按钮时候,定义一个字符串Message,用来存放输入框文字。...再将Message存放输入框文字传递给子窗体定义可读可写公用字符串getMessage。下面看一下实现后台代码: 父窗体后台代码: ? 子窗体后台代码: ?...这里我进行假设一个场景,依然还是有父子窗体,子窗体是父窗体中一个按钮属性设置器,在子窗体添上要设置属性,然后按设置完成,子窗体关闭,父窗体相应按钮属性也根据子窗体设置而改变!

2.3K10
领券